Recognizing this potential, Yahoo has decided to enhance its AI capabilities by leveraging Google Cloud’s AI platform. Initially, these AI features were only available to iOS users, but now Yahoo has made them accessible to users on web browsers as well.
One of the new AI features introduced by Yahoo is the Shopping Saver, a shopping assistance tool. This feature scours users’ inboxes to uncover hidden gift cards, discount codes, and store credits. It then helps users draft messages that utilize these savings even after the purchase is made. Yahoo claims that this feature is unique to Yahoo Mail. Josh Jacobson, senior vice president and general manager of Yahoo Mail, expressed his enthusiasm for this addition, stating that the Shopping Saver will save users time and money, moving towards creating an assistive inbox. Additionally, Yahoo revealed that nearly half of all adults in the United States have at least one unused discount code or gift card, making the Shopping Saver particularly valuable.
In addition to the Shopping Saver, Yahoo has introduced several other AI features to enhance the user experience in Yahoo Mail. One such feature is an improved search mode that allows users to ask questions or choose from suggested prompts to find old emails, instead of relying solely on keyword searches. This makes searching for specific information within email threads much more efficient. Another noteworthy addition is the writing assistant, which guides users in selecting the most appropriate tone for their emails. This can greatly benefit users who may struggle with composing formal or professional emails by providing them with helpful suggestions and guidelines. Finally, Yahoo Mail now includes a message summary feature that highlights important information within an email, making it easier for users to quickly grasp the key details without having to read through the entire message.
